Entry table
-dimensions: h 32" w 22" d 14" -materials: reclaimed, quarter sawn, douglas fir, yellow pine, machine clamp -process: This table is inspired by the art deco movement. I like the dichotomy of using discarded materials in a very labor intensive process. I find materials in any number of places and this piece was built of veneer made from old gymnasium benches.
I design and build furniture with both reclaimed lumber and unusual grades of wood. My pieces also have, as a focal point, antique tools, machine parts, and other scrapped objects. As a designer builder I follow various theories of the original English and European Arts and Crafts movements of the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ries.
